Braves LHP Max Fried to return Sunday vs. Marlins
Atlanta Braves left-hander Max Fried will return from the injured list Sunday to face the Miami Marlins, manager Brian Snitker told reporters Saturday.,Fried has been on the IL since July 21 with left forearm neuritis. ,He last pitched for the Braves on July 11. Lakers unveil statue of Kobe, Gianna Bryant
On the symbolic date of 8/2/24, the Los Angeles Lakers unveiled the second of three statues commissioned to honor Kobe Bryant near Crypto.com Arena.,The new statue depicts Bryant alongside his daughter Gianna.
